1. Important Safety Instructions

READ THE INSTRUCTIONS: Read and retain these instructions for future reference. Adhere to all warnings printed here and on the console and its power unit.

COVERS: Do not remove the power unit cover. Operate the console with its cover correctly fitted. Refer servicing work to authorised personnel only.

MAINS POWER: Connect the console power unit to a mains power supply only of the type described in this user guide and marked on the unit. The power source must provide a good ground connection. Do not remove or tamper with the ground connection in the power cord. Use the power cord with a sealed mains plug appropriate for your local mains supply as provided with the console. Route the power cord so that it is not likely to be walked on, stretched or pinched by items placed upon or against it.

INSTALLATION: Install the console and its power unit in accordance with the instructions printed in this user guide. Do not connect the output of power amplifiers directly to the console. Use audio connectors and plugs only for their intended purpose.

VENTILATION: Ensure adequate ventilation around the console and its power unit. Do not obstruct the ventilation slots or position the unit where the air flow required for ventilation is impeded.

MOISTURE: To reduce the risk of fire or electric shock do not expose the equipment to rain or moisture or use it in damp or wet conditions. Do not place containers of liquids on it, which might spill into any openings.

ENVIRONMENT: Locate the units away from direct sunlight and any equipment which produces heat, such as power supplies, amplifiers and heaters. Protect from excessive dirt, dust, heat and vibration when operating and storing. Avoid tobacco ash, drinks spillage and smoke, especially that associated with smoke machines. Do not mount the power supply on any surface subject to resonance or vibration.

HANDLING: To prevent damage to the controls and cosmetics avoid placing heavy objects on the console surfaces, scratching the surface with sharp objects, or rough handling and vibration. Protect the controls from damage during transit. Use adequate packing if you need to ship the unit.

2. Overview

Following the worldwide success of the Radius 2 and 4 analogue rotary DJ mixers, MasterSounds and Union Audio continue their award-winning partnership with the launch of the Linear 4V and Radius 4V valve DJ mixers.

The Linear 4V & Radius 4V have been designed by Union Audio and MasterSounds and developed by Union Audio at their Cornwall-based workshops. Andy Rigby-Jones, former head of design for the world-renowned Allen & Heath Xone DJ mixer range, personally designed, built, and tested the analogue electronics, whilst MasterSounds founder Ryan Shaw worked on the mixer's feature set and sound.

Each mixer is lovingly hand-built, tested, and shipped directly from Union Audio, ensuring the ultimate in quality, reliability, and performance.

Andy says: "The Linear 4V & Radius 4V's signal path features pure high-end analogue topology for minimal distortion, low noise floor, and high headroom, aided by only using components of the highest quality. The addition of a fully discreet mix stage further adds to the sound quality of our unique creation."

With more than twenty years' experience of DJing, as well as a background in design and manufacturing, MasterSounds founder Ryan Shaw says: "The Linear 4V and Radius 4V are a fabulous addition to the MasterSounds range and are a response to customers who loved the Radius 2 and 4's design, but required a more traditional mixer layout, including 3 band EQ, LED meter on each channel, and a cross fader. The addition of a valve on each of the 4 input channels adds to the Linear 4V & Radius 4V's unique feature set and beautiful sound."

The Linear 4V and Radius 4V offer a fantastic clean, open, and dynamic sound on both LINE and RIAA inputs across all 4 channels, as well as great usability. The mixer features easy-reading backlit VU Meters, a responsive Master EQ/Isolator, 3 band EQ per channel, assignable cross fader, LED meter on each channel, and an Aux send system.

A unique feature is the ability to reconfigure the Aux Return Jacks as a Mix Buss Insert, giving the user unparalleled flexibility for FX integration, simply at the press of a button. This system marries perfectly with the MasterSounds FX unit.

And last but not least, the addition of two Mic inputs gives 4V the club standard specification seal of approval.

3. Front Panel Controls

Channel Controls (CH 1-4)

  • MIC I/P SELECT: Selects microphone input on CH1 & CH2 (located on rear panel).
  • TRIM: Adjusts input signal level from OFF to +10dBu for accurate level matching.
  • LINE/RIAA: Selects between RIAA (Phono) or LINE input level.
  • 3 BAND EQ: HIGH, MID, LOW equalization system providing -20dB cut and +6dB boost per band.
  • CUE: Routes the channel signal to the headphones, indicated by a red LED.
  • VALVE SLOT: Four slots on the front panel, each housing a valve with a red LED glow.
  • XFADE SWITCH: Assigns the cross fader to the desired channel (X or Y). 'OFF' bypasses the cross fader.
  • LED METER: 10-bar meter showing input signal level from -25dB to PK (Peak Signal). Normal operating range is -6dB to +6dB.
  • CH1-CH4 ROTARY FADER (Radius 4V): Controls channel level, from fully off (anti-clockwise) to unity gain (0dB, clockwise).
  • CH1-CH4 LINEAR FADER (Linear 4V): Controls channel level, from fully down (off) to unity gain (0dB).

Master and Monitoring Controls

  • VU METERS: Two analogue VU meters displaying left and right audio signals (post EQ). Meters illuminate RED over +6VU to warn against clipping. In SPLIT MODE, LEFT meter shows CUE level, RIGHT meter shows MIX level.
  • MASTER EQ/ISOLATOR: Functions as an isolator with 12dB/octave filters at 350Hz and 3.5kHz, also usable as a Master EQ.
  • MASTER: Adjusts signal level to the Main Output XLRs (House Mix) from off to +10dBu gain.
  • BOOTH: Adjusts signal level to the Booth Output TRS Jacks (Monitor Mix) from off to +10dBu gain.
  • SPLIT: When activated, links CUE buttons and VU Meters. The Left VU Meter shows CUE signal, Right VU Meter shows MIX signal. Sends cued source to Left headphone and mix to Right headphone.
  • PHONES: Controls headphone output level. A 1/4 inch jack headphone input is located on the front.
  • X FADE CONTOUR: Adjusts the cross fader slope for various mixing styles, from mild blending to sharp cuts.
  • ADD MIX: Controls the amount of stereo house mix sent to the cued track in headphones.
  • CROSS FADER: High-quality Penny & Giles cross fader for mixing between signals assigned to X or Y.

4. Rear Panel Controls

  • MASTER OUT: XLR output for balanced equipment (monitors, amplifiers). Output level is +14dBu at full gain.
  • AUX SEND & RETURN/INSERT: 1/4 inch TRS jack sockets for connecting external FX units. SEND connects to FX input, RETURN connects to FX output.
  • INSERT ON BUTTON: Reconfigures Aux Return Jacks as a Mix Buss Insert for FX integration.
  • GROUND POST: For connecting turntable ground leads.
  • RECORD OUT: Twin RCA sockets for stereo recording. Output level is -6dBu, unaffected by Master Output volume.
  • BOOTH OUT: 1/4 inch TRS jack output for the DJ's booth monitor system.
  • POWER SWITCH: "0" for OFF. Press the "-" [power-symbol] to power ON with the external power supply connected.
  • POWER INPUT SOCKET: Connects the external 18-19V power supply.
  • CH ONE-CH FOUR: Four sets of LINE and PHONO RCA inputs. PHONO inputs provide gain and RIAA equalization for turntables. LINE inputs are for CD players.
  • MIC 1 MIC 2 INPUTS: Two female XLR sockets for connecting two microphones.
  • MIC ON: Buttons to enable microphone inputs on CH1 & CH2.

Using the External Send & Return System

Connect Mixer Aux Send outputs to FX unit inputs and FX unit outputs to mixer Aux Returns. Set FX unit to unity gain. Adjusting the channel send control feeds the channel signal to the FX unit for effects like echo, delay, or reverb. The PRE button allows the AUX send to take signal before the channel fader, enabling effects to be introduced even when the fader is down.

MIX INSERT

The Aux Return Jack Sockets can be reconfigured as a Mix Buss Insert point by pressing the INSERT ON BUTTON. This allows the entire mix to be processed through external devices like compressors or equalisers. The 1/4 inch TRS Jacks function as a conventional mixer insert, with the Tip as SEND and the Ring as RETURN.

5. Warranty

MasterSounds warrants the Mixer to be free of defects in workmanship and materials for twenty-four months (2 years) from the date of delivery.

Conditions:

  • Failure not due to improper installation, operation, cleaning, maintenance, accident, damage, misuse, abuse, or non-approved modifications.
  • Warranty does not cover normal wear and tear or events outside MasterSounds control.
  • Faulty products must be returned to MasterSounds or an authorised service agent with proof of purchase, packed in the original shipping box. Contact MasterSounds before shipping.
  • Warranty applies only to the original purchaser and is not transferable.
  • MasterSounds may, at its discretion, repair or replace the defective product with an equivalent service exchange item.
  • This warranty is the purchaser's sole remedy. MasterSounds is not liable for other repair costs or damages related to malfunction.

The MasterSounds 4V complies with European Electromagnetic Compatibility directives (2014/30/EU) and Low Voltage directives (2014/35/EU).

6. Technical Specification

Dimensions & Weight

  • Dimensions: 350W x 282D x 80H
  • Weight: 4.75KG
  • Packed Dimensions: 460W x 360D x 180H
  • Packed weight: 6.3KG

Power Requirement

  • External Power Supply: Universal 90V - 265V AC 50/60Hz
  • DC Internal Power Rails: 18-18-19V 50W Max, +/- 18V DC

Audio Performance

  • Residual Output Noise: <-97dBu (20Hz to 20kHz un-weighted)
  • Mix noise Unity Line IN to Mix Out: <-89dBu (20Hz to 20kHz un-weighted)
  • Distortion THD+N: <0.01% Line IN to Mix OUT 0dBu
  • Dynamic Range: >116dB
  • Maximum Signal Level: ±27dBu
  • Frequency Response: 10Hz - 50kHz +0/-1dB
  • Headphone Output Power: 800mW RMS into 32 Ohms

EQ/Filters

  • Channel EQ: 3 Band -20/+6dB
  • Channel EQ Frequency: 100Hz, 1kHz, 5kHz
  • Master EQ/Isolator Cut/Boost: OFF to +12dB
  • Master EQ/Isolator Crossover Fc: 350Hz and 3.5kHz
  • RIAA Accuracy: Within 0.25dB 40Hz - 20kHz.
